Page 1 of 3 SI B64 02 15 Heating and Air Conditioning May 2015 Technical Service SUBJECT A/C Makes Unusual Whistling Noise from Center Vents MODEL F15 (X5) F16 (X6) F85 (X5 M) F86 (X6 M) Produced from July 31, 2013 to February 12, 2015 SITUATION An unusual whistling noise can be heard coming from the center vent area for approximately15 seconds after the A/C is switched on. CAUSE Evaporator in the A/C system PROCEDURE 1. Using ISTA, perform a vehicle test and complete all test plans for related stored fault codes. 2. If there are no fault codes stored, proceed to the next step and replace the evaporator. 3. Refer to Repair Instruction 64 11 206 and the B640215 attachment. Necessary preliminary tasks: • Drain off the air conditioning system. • Remove the support for the dashboard. • Unclip the wiring harness mounting from the heater. • Remove the fresh air duct. • Remove the acoustic cover. • Remove the center console. N63T only: • Remove the intake silencer housing. Always connect a BMW approved battery charger/power supply (SI B04 23 10). PARTS INFORMATION Part Number Description Quantity 64 11 9 386 812 Evaporator 1 https://www.bmwtis.net/tiscode/cgi-bin/bulletin.aspx?sie_path=/tsb/bulletins/htm_store/235... 6/4/2015 Page 2 of 3 83 19 2 221 349 R134a (Gas “one” ounce units) As needed WARRANTY INFORMATION Covered under the terms of the BMW New Vehicle/SAV Limited Warranty or the BMW Certified PreOwned Program. Defect Code: 64 51 00 78 00 All models listed Labor Operation: 00 00 006 Labor Allowance: Description: Refer to KSD2 Performing “vehicle test” (with vehicle diagnosis system – checking faults) Refer to KSD2 Connect an approved battery charger/power supply (indicated in KSD2 as “Charging battery”) Labor Allowance: Description: Refer to KSD2 Removing and installing or replacing the heater (includes discharging, evacuating and filling air conditioner) Refer to KSD2 Removing and installing or replacing the evaporator (heater/air conditioner removed) And: 61 21 528 And for the: F15 (X5) and F16 (X6) Labor Operation: 64 11 703 And: 64 51 591 If you are using a Main labor code for another repair, use the Plus code labor operation 00 00 556 instead. Refer to KSD2 for the corresponding flat rate unit (FRU) allowances. Or for the: F85 (X5 M) and F86 (X6 M) Note: Please claim this portion of the repair as outlined below until the applicable labor operations are available in KSD2. https://www.bmwtis.net/tiscode/cgi-bin/bulletin.aspx?sie_path=/tsb/bulletins/htm_store/235... 6/4/2015 Page 3 of 3 Labor Operation: 64 99 000 Labor Allowance: Description: 91 FRU Work time for removing and installing or replacing the heater (includes discharging, evacuating and filling air conditioner) and removing and installing or replacing the evaporator (heater/air conditioner removed) Even though work time labor operation code 64 99 000 ends in “000,” it is not considered a Main labor operation. Also, since the “work time” FRU allowance to be claimed is specified, a separate punch time is not required. However, an explanation on the repair order and the claim comments is required. Other Repairs If performing the ISTA diagnostics and related test plans results with other eligible and covered work, claim this work with the applicable defect code and/or labor operations listed in KSD2.
